Stripteaser II is a gritty dive into the underbelly of L.A.'s nightlife, crafted by Karl Ernest. The film has this raw energy, as Rick, the cabbie, navigates a world filled with desperation and danger while searching for his sister. The atmosphere is thick with tension, and the pacing keeps you on edge, blending the thriller genre with a touch of noir. Angie's character pulls you in - she’s not just there to dance; her backstory adds layers to the narrative. The practical effects, while not groundbreaking, lend a certain authenticity to the harsher realities depicted. It’s a film that doesn’t shy away from the darker themes of family, loss, and survival amidst chaos.
